Paid Social Manager (Remote or NYC-Based)

Remote, USA Full-time
Job DescriptionDignotion is seeking a performance-driven Paid Social Manager to lead campaign strategy and execution across major social media platforms. You'll join a senior, agile team that works with clients ranging from fast-growing startups to global brands-with a strong focus on measurable impact and creative excellence. In this role, you'll own paid social campaign management from start to finish: planning, deployment, optimization, reporting, and collaboration with creatives. This is a great opportunity for someone comfortable working independently, with deep experience in paid media and a passion for results.Key Responsibilities• Launch, manage, and optimize paid campaigns across Facebook/Meta, Instagram, TikTok, Snapchat, LinkedIn, and other networks• Develop media plans and set campaign structures to support growth and efficiency goals• Analyze performance data and build actionable reports with budget pacing and KPI tracking• Conduct account audits and provide recommendations for structure and targeting improvements• Collaborate with internal teams to brief creative requirements and suggest optimizations• Stay up to date on platform changes, policy updates, and industry trendsRequirements• 2-3 years of hands-on experience managing paid social campaigns• Strong command of major ad platforms (Meta Ads Manager, TikTok Ads, LinkedIn, etc.)• Proven ability to manage budgets, analyze data, and meet performance targets• Comfortable building reports and working with performance metrics in Excel or bolthires Sheets• Clear written and spoken English; confident in communication and documentation• Able to work independently and manage timelines with minimal oversightBonus Points If You Have:• Experience in high-performance or regulated verticals (iGaming, finance, health, etc.)• Familiarity with creative testing frameworks and audience segmentation strategies• Experience with dynamic creatives or product feeds• Exposure to attribution modeling, conversion tracking, or third-party analytics toolsBenefits• Fully remote or hybrid (NYC-based optional)• Flexible working hours with a results-first mindset• Opportunity to work with a senior team across competitive markets• Project-based or part-time engagement tailored to your availability and expertise Apply tot his job
